Concrete porch repair services involve restoring and improving the structural integrity and appearance of existing porch surfaces made from concrete. This process typically includes addressing issues such as cracks, spalling, uneven surfaces, and surface deterioration. Skilled contractors may perform patching, resurfacing, leveling, and sealing to ensure the porch is safe, functional, and visually appealing. Proper repair not only enhances curb appeal but also helps prevent further damage that could lead to more costly repairs in the future.

Many concrete porches develop problems over time due to weather exposure, heavy foot traffic, or shifting ground. Cracks can form, allowing water to seep in and cause further deterioration. Surface spalling or chipping may occur, creating uneven or unsafe walking surfaces. Repair services help solve these issues by sealing cracks, restoring damaged areas, and reinforcing the overall structure. This work can extend the lifespan of the porch and maintain its usability, especially in regions with harsh weather conditions.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Porch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- minor cracks, chips, or surface repairs typ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ine patching j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age and surface area.

Moderate Repairs - fixing larger cracks or resurfacing a worn porch often ranges from $600 to $1,500. These projects are common and usually involve more extensive work to restore the surface.

Full Replacement - replacing an entire concrete porch can cost between $2,500 and $5,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ects tend to push into higher price ranges, but many jobs are completed at the lower end of this spectrum.

Custom or Complex Projects - specialty finishes, decorative overlays, or structural modifications can exceed $5,000. These higher-tier projects are less common but are handled by local contractors for clients seeking specific design or functional outcomes.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of concrete porch damage can be repaired? Local contractors can handle a variety of issues including cracks, spalling, uneven surfaces, and surface deterioration to restore the porch's appearance and safety.

How do professionals typically repair cracks in a concrete porch? Repair methods often involve cleaning the crack, applying a suitable filler or epoxy, and finishing to match the existing surface for a seamless look.

Can damaged concrete porches be resurfaced instead of replaced? Yes, resurfacing is a common option that involves applying a new layer of concrete or overlay to improve appearance and extend the lifespan of the existing porch.

What are common signs that a concrete porch needs repair? Visible cracks, uneven settling, surface spalling, and water pooling are typical indicators that professional repair may be necessary.
